Four In Custody Accused Of Leading Authorities On Chase Through Worthington

Tuesday November 20, 2012 8:09 AM
UPDATED: Tuesday November 20, 2012 8:11 AM

Four people were taken into custody after at least five law enforcement agencies chase the suspects through a Worthington neighborhood Monday night.

The chase occurred in the neighborhoods near state Routes 315 and 161. Neighbors stayed inside their homes while a police helicopter searched from above.

Investigators said that the incident was drug related and that those involved in the chase were driving a car from out of state.

WBNS-10TV was there as police took one of the people into custody. Authorities ran through a suburban neighborhood, tracking the suspects after they ditched the vehicle along S.R. 315.

Authorities said that six people were inside the vehicle. K9 officers tracked the suspects. Investigators believed that while four arrests were made, two others remained loose.

The identities of those in custody were not released. It was not known if charges were filed.
